From what I understand, there are various versions of the Bob Dylan b**tleg LP Little White Wonder (which contained 1967 recordings from the Basement Tapes). Renowned Dutch underground comics artist Peter Pontiac at the time drew the very wonderful cover for what was to become the second version of this record.One of those behind this release was my uncle, who was very much part of the Amsterdam underground scene at the time - Ton Schreuder (himself a musician who was a member of amongst others psych/jazz/avant garde outfit Ahora Mazda, who made an album which is very wanted amongst collectors ... but that's another story altogether). He was also involved in a fair few of those highly sought after early 70's b**tleg albums. My uncle passed away one and a half year ago, way too soon, and he left behind a small treasure of albums.
In his collection was also this unused print of a Pontiac drawn cover. His widow, my aunt, asked me if this might be worth anything to collectors ... I said I'd try, so here it is. The vinyl never made it in there; they simply had a few covers too many back when this was released some 35 years ago. As it is a very nice item on its own even without the vinyl, my uncle never wanted to throw it away. So all those years later, he is gone, but the cover is still here.
